Differences between BCom and BBA course of Banking and Insurance?
Sir, I am interested to do BCom course in the specialization of Banking and Insurance. But I have heard that BBA also has the same specialization. Can I know what are the differences between these two courses? Please let me know immediately.

Re: Differences between BCom and BBA course of Banking and Insurance?
BCom and BBA, both are 3 year course and both have their own equal value. The major key difference between B.Com banking and BBA banking is BCom deals with the study of basic principles involved in the banking field, whereas BBA deals with the management of various fields involved in the banking sector.
Although employment areas for both are same, but their job profiles are different. |
